Follow
Ahmed Hassan
Title
Cited by
Cited by
Year
Optimistic transactional boosting
A Hassan, R Palmieri, B Ravindran
Proceedings of the 19th ACM SIGPLAN symposium on Principles and practice of …, 2014
572014
NUMASK: high performance scalable skip list for NUMA
H Daly, A Hassan, MF Spear, R Palmieri
32nd International Symposium on Distributed Computing (DISC 2018), 2018
332018
On developing optimistic transactional lazy set
A Hassan, R Palmieri, B Ravindran
Principles of Distributed Systems: 18th International Conference, OPODIS …, 2014
252014
Remote invalidation: Optimizing the critical path of memory transactions
A Hassan, R Palmieri, B Ravindran
2014 IEEE 28th International Parallel and Distributed Processing Symposium …, 2014
122014
Managing resource limitation of best-effort HTM
M Mohamedin, R Palmieri, A Hassan, B Ravindran
Proceedings of the 27th ACM symposium on Parallelism in Algorithms and …, 2015
92015
Integrating transactionally boosted data structures with stm frameworks: A case study on set
A Hassan, R Palmieri, B Ravindran
9th ACM SIGPLAN Workshop on Transactional Computing (TRANSACT), 2014
92014
Bundling linked data structures for linearizable range queries
J Nelson-Slivon, A Hassan, R Palmieri
Proceedings of the 27th ACM SIGPLAN Symposium on Principles and Practice of …, 2022
82022
Transactional interference-less balanced tree
A Hassan, R Palmieri, B Ravindran
Distributed Computing: 29th International Symposium, DISC 2015, Tokyo, Japan …, 2015
82015
Bundled references: an abstraction for highly-concurrent linearizable range queries
J Nelson, A Hassan, R Palmieri
Proceedings of the 26th ACM SIGPLAN Symposium on Principles and Practice of …, 2021
72021
Nemo: NUMA-aware concurrency control for scalable transactional memory
M Mohamedin, S Peluso, MJ Kishi, A Hassan, R Palmieri
Proceedings of the 47th International Conference on Parallel Processing, 1-10, 2018
62018
Extending TM primitives using low level semantics
MM Saad, R Palmieri, A Hassan, B Ravindran
Proceedings of the 28th ACM Symposium on Parallelism in Algorithms and …, 2016
62016
KVCG: A heterogeneous key-value store for skewed workloads
P Miller, J Nelson, A Hassan, R Palmieri
Proceedings of the 14th ACM International Conference on Systems and Storage …, 2021
52021
Optimistic transactional boosting
A Hassan, R Palmieri, S Peluso, B Ravindran
IEEE Transactions on Parallel and Distributed Systems 28 (12), 3600-3614, 2017
52017
HATS: Hardware-assisted transaction scheduler
Z Chen, A Hassan, M Javidi Kishi, J Nelson, R Palmieri
Leibniz international proceedings in informatics, 2020
32020
Remote transaction commit: Centralizing software transactional memory commits
A Hassan, R Palmieri, B Ravindran
IEEE Transactions on Computers 65 (7), 2228-2240, 2015
32015
Exploiting locality in scalable ordered maps
M Rodriguez, A Hassan, M Spear
Proceedings of the ACM International Conference on Parallel Architectures …, 2020
22020
Opacity vs TMS2: expectations and reality
S Hans, A Hassan, R Palmieri, S Peluso, B Ravindran
Distributed Computing: 30th International Symposium, DISC 2016, Paris …, 2016
22016
Towards efficient top-k fuzzy auto-completion queries
M AbdelNaby, ME Khalefa, Y Taha, A Hassan
Alexandria Engineering Journal 61 (7), 5783-5791, 2022
12022
Semantic conflict detection for transactional data structure libraries
Y Sheng, A Hassan, M Spear
Proceedings of the 33rd ACM symposium on parallelism in algorithms and …, 2021
12021
On Building Modular and Elastic Data Structures with Bulk Operations
K Williams, J Foster, A Srivirote, A Hassan, J Tassarotti, L Tseng, ...
Proceedings of the 22nd International Conference on Distributed Computing …, 2021
12021
The system can't perform the operation now. Try again later.
Articles 1–20